Spellings

Here are your spelling words this week. What do you notice? Can you spot our spelling pattern this week?

communicate, community, committee, immediately, recommend, programme, grammar, accommodate, swimming, commutative.

Ideally, ask an adult at home to test you on these words first. Next, practise each word 3 times – especially any that you spelt incorrectly. Finally, put each word into a sentence.
